Introduction

Planet of the Apes (2001) is a science fiction movie directed by Tim Burton and starring Mark Wahlberg, Tim Roth, Helena Bonham Carter, Michael Clarke Duncan, and Estella Warren. The movie is a remake of the 1968 basic of the identical title, and follows astronaut Leo Davidson (Wahlberg) as he crash-lands on a mysterious planet dominated by clever apes. After being captured and enslaved by the apes, Leo should find a technique to escape and return to Earth. The Solid of Planet Apes 2001Planet Apes 2001

The solid of Planet of the Apes (2001) included Mark Wahlberg as Captain Leo Davidson, Tim Roth as Normal Thade, Helena Bonham Carter as Ari, Michael Clarke Duncan as Attar, Paul Giamatti as Limbo, Estella Warren as Daena, and Cary-Hiroyuki Tagawa as Krull.
